@AaronM, to attempt at clarifying, the Bridge 2.0 switches most supplemental lifts every 4 weeks, that's correct. The Strength template just runs longer (12 weeks vs. 7) and sometimes switches supplemental lifts more often than 4 weeks (has some lifts for 1 week, some for 2 weeks, some for 3, 4, etc.). Both programs keep the competition lifts the same throughout, and each program does the main competition lift 1x per week.

As far as actual numbers go:
The Bridge 2.0 has 13 different lifts. (Note that I am not comparing "The Bridge" (1.0) as it was not included on their templates that I purchased)
12 week Strength Template has 25 different lifts.
